What Is Wild Horse Islands?
Wild Horse Islands is a Roblox adventure game created on June 22, 2021 by the Happy Acres studio. The game drops you onto a series of interconnected islands filled with wild horses, farming resources, and quests. With a 92% positive rating and over 627,000 favorites, it's one of the most beloved animal games on the platform.
Each server holds up to 20 players, and the game hit an all-time peak of 25,026 concurrent players. You'll spend your time catching horses with crafted lassos, training them for races, managing crops, and trading with other players. The core loop is simple but surprisingly deep once you start chasing rare horse breeds and stat combinations.

How to Catch & Train Horses in 2026
Catching horses is the heart of Wild Horse Islands. It's straightforward once you understand the tools and timing, but there are real differences between a new player fumbling with a stick lasso and a veteran snagging rare breeds with a clear quartz lasso. Here's the step-by-step process.
- Craft your first lasso. Gather 3 copper and 1 rope to build a copper lasso. This costs 98 tokens total and is your gateway to catching horses.
- Explore islands for wild horses. Different islands host different breeds. Move between them to find the horses you want. Watch for rare breeds with unique coat patterns.
- Approach carefully and throw your lasso. Get close without spooking the horse, then throw. Tagging a horse claims it for you -- other players can't take a tagged horse.
- Upgrade your lasso. Ditch the copper lasso as soon as you can. Amethyst, ruby, and clear quartz lassos give much better catch rates and are worth the investment.
- Decide: sell or keep. Sell common horses to NPC Larry for 100-500 tokens each. Keep rare horses with high purity, good stats, or mismatch coat colors.
- Head to Training Island. Talk to the NPC by the well to pick up quests. Complete them to earn training receipts you can turn in at Steven's truck.
- Train your keeper horses. Use training receipts to boost speed, stamina, and other stats. For racing mounts, aim for +5 speed training on high-purity Thoroughbreds.
What Are Horse Mismatches?
A "mismatch" is a horse born with two different natural hair colors. These aren't dyed -- they're genuinely rare genetic outcomes. Mismatched horses are highly prized by collectors and traders, often selling for significantly more than standard horses of the same breed.
When you spot a mismatch in the wild, catch it immediately. Don't hesitate. These horses hold their value and make excellent trading assets. Even if the breed itself isn't top-tier, the mismatch factor adds serious demand.
Token Farming Strategies for 2026
Tokens are the primary currency in Wild Horse Islands. You need them for crafting, buying supplies, traveling between islands, and upgrading your farm. Here are the most efficient ways to stack tokens right now.
Selling Horses to Larry
NPC Larry buys horses for 100-500 tokens depending on the breed and rarity. This is the most accessible method for new players. Catch a batch of horses, ride to Larry, and sell everything you don't want to keep. It's not glamorous, but it's consistent income.
Lava Rod AFK Fishing
This is the big one. With a Lava Rod, you can earn 100,000+ tokens overnight while AFK. You'll need to complete the mainland quests first to get your fishing rod, then upgrade to the Lava Rod through gameplay progression. Set up your character at a fishing spot, make sure your device stays awake, and let the tokens roll in.
Quest Completion
Training Island quests reward training receipts, which you trade at Steven's truck. But the mainland quests also give solid token rewards. Don't skip dialogue -- some NPCs offer multi-step quest chains that pay out well at the end.
Farming & Selling Crops
Growing and selling crops provides steady passive income. With the Expert Farmer game pass, your crops grow twice as fast and you get a 10% seed return rate. This makes farming a genuinely viable token source rather than just a side activity.

Racing Guide -- Building the Perfect Mount in 2026
Racing is one of the most competitive aspects of Wild Horse Islands. Your results depend almost entirely on the horse you bring. Here's what you need to know to build a winner.
The Ideal Racing Horse
You want a Thoroughbred. Specifically, you want one with OG (original) speed -- this means the horse spawned with naturally high speed stats rather than relying entirely on training. Combine that with 100% purity and +5 speed training, and you've got a mount that'll consistently place first.
Purity matters because it determines how closely a horse matches its breed's ideal stat distribution. A 100% pure Thoroughbred has maximum base speed potential. Lower purity means lower stat ceilings, no matter how much you train.
Training for Speed
Training receipts from Training Island quests are your main resource here. Each receipt spent on speed training pushes your horse closer to that +5 cap. Don't waste receipts on other stats if you're building a dedicated racer -- focus everything on speed.
Farming & Dyeing Tips for 2026
Farming isn't just about making tokens. Certain crops let you dye your horses, which is both a cosmetic flex and a way to increase trade value for some buyers. Here's the color breakdown.
Natural Dye Colors
Four food resources produce dyes in Wild Horse Islands:
- Blackberry -- produces black dye
- Corn -- produces yellow dye
- Raspberry -- produces red dye
- Blueberry -- produces blue dye
Grow these crops on your farm or forage them in the wild. The Expert Farmer game pass doubles growth speed for all crops, making dye production much faster. Keep a rotation of all four going so you always have options.
One thing to remember: dyed horses are different from mismatched horses. A dyed horse has an artificially applied color. A mismatch has two natural colors from birth. Collectors generally value mismatches more, but custom dye jobs still look great and can attract buyers who want a specific aesthetic.
